Abstract

The utility model discloses a pin-connected truss girder, which comprises a plurality of main girder standard sections and connecting plates, wherein each connecting plate is arranged between adjacent two main girder standard sections. One end of each connecting plate is fixedly installed at one end of one main girder standard section through a fixing device, and the other end of each connecting plate is fixedly installed at the end part of the adjacent main girder standard section through a plurality of pin shafts and split pins matched with the pin shafts. A through hole is formed in one end of each pin shaft, and each split pin penetrates in each through hole. The two adjacent main girder standard sections are fixed together through the pin shafts. When the length of the truss girder is increased, in order to correspondingly increase the strength of joints, only several pin shafts are added at the joints. The structure is beneficial to the standardization of the product.

Background technique
Lattice girder generally is fixed together by connection set by some girder standard knots, traditional connection set comprises a plate and the bearing pin that diameter is larger, connecting plate one end is fixed on an end of a girder standard knot in advance, the other end is fixedly connected with another girder standard knot by a larger bearing pin of diameter, when lattice girder length is larger, consider the relation of intensity, above-mentioned Placement generally satisfies the requirement of structural strength by the diameter that strengthens bearing pin.This mode is unfavorable for the standardization of product, is necessary existing product is improved design for this reason.
The model utility content
In order to address the above problem, the utility model provides a kind of lattice girder that adopts pin to connect.
The technological scheme that its technical problem that solves the utility model adopts is:
A kind of lattice girder that adopts pin to connect, comprise some girder standard knots and be arranged on connecting plate between the adjacent two girder standard knots, connecting plate one end fixedly mounts a therein end of a girder standard knot by fixing device, the other end of described connecting plate reaches the end that the cotter pin that cooperates with bearing pin is fixed on another girder standard knot by some bearing pins, described bearing pin one end is provided with through hole, and cotter pin is arranged in this through hole.
Described fixing device comprises some riveting pins.
The beneficial effects of the utility model are: adopt the utility model of said structure by adopting a plurality of bearing pins that two girder standard knots are fixed together, when lattice girder length increases, be the corresponding intensity that increases the joint, only need the joint to increase several bearing pins and get final product, be beneficial to the standardization of product.
